Can you go to the beach in Florida in January?

The Gulf beaches are only warmer than the Atlantic in the summer. By January, water temps even as far south on the Gulf as Naples/Marco Island are mid-to-high 60s. On the Atlantic side, the Gulf Stream comes close to shore between Miami and Palm Beach, so water temps should be low 70s.

Is West Palm Beach warm in January?

Daily high temperatures are around 74°F, rarely falling below 66°F or exceeding 81°F. The lowest daily average high temperature is 74°F on January 14. Daily low temperatures are around 60°F, rarely falling below 46°F or exceeding 72°F.

How warm is Key Largo in January?

January Weather in Key Largo Florida, United States. Daily high temperatures are around 76°F, rarely falling below 68°F or exceeding 82°F. The lowest daily average high temperature is 75°F on January 18. Daily low temperatures are around 64°F, rarely falling below 52°F or exceeding 73°F.

Which side of Florida has the warmest water?

As a general rule, the water anywhere in Florida will be warm enough to swim between April and October. During the cooler months, the farther south you go, the warmer it will be. Fort Lauderdale, Miami, the Keys, Marco Island and Naples will have the warmest water during the winter.

Is there any part of Florida that is not humid?

During the winter, north Florida and the Panhandle is much less humid than South Florida due to colder winter temperatures. Remember, colder air holds much less water vapor than warm air, so the colder parts of Florida will be less humid that warmer areas further south.
